March 31, 2010
Budget Update
The Board of Education approved the final budget for the 2010-2011 school year on March 30 at a public hearing held in the Westfield High School cafeteria. The budget of $89,377,980 includes $84,477,022 for the General Operating Fund, of which $81,379,595 should be raised as a 4% tax levy. The $81,379,595 number will appear on the ballot for voters on April 20.
Superintendent of Schools, Dr. Margaret Dolan, reported that the fall dramas in the intermediate schools, intermediate and high school intramurals, and 8th grade sports have been restored to the budget. Student activity fees will be instituted to help defray the costs of the extra-curricular activities.

March 23, 2010
Re-Constructing A Budget
With Less than 1% of State Aid
Superintendent of Schools, Dr. Margaret Dolan, addressed the Board of Education and the public at Westfield High School on March 23 with a proposed budget for 2010-2011 that must take into consideration a $4.2 million cut in state aid. Following the Commissioner's announcement on March 2, the school district expected a maximum cut of $750,000 in state aid. On March 17, a day after the Governor's budget address, the district was informed that state aid would be cut $4.22 million.
The proposed budget, outlined in the attached Powerpoint presentation, was presented to the entire Board of Education and the public on March 23. The budget can be modified up until Tuesday, March 30, when the Board will adopt the final budget to be presented to the voters of Westfield on April 20, 2010. Dr. Dolan had previously made requests to our representatives in Trenton to postpone the date of the school election in order to give Westfield time to prepare a thoughtful budget and to determine what "tools" districts would receive from the Governor. Assemblyman Bramnick informed the Board and Superintendent that under normal circumstances, the legislature is not expected to convene again until May.
